There was a lack of commitment. … and so on. Especially in lateral leadership the question about commitment of ...Leaders cultivate commitment. And, as we have found in our research, the members of exceptional groups, not just the person in a position of authority, cultivate commitment in each other. Creating and sustaining commitment is leadership in action—and it is a collective process.Mar 10, 2023 · The theory identifies four situational leadership styles: Directing (S1): High on directing behaviors, low on supporting behaviors. Here are a few steps you can take to promote safety leadership in the workplace: 1. Identify and establish safety leaders. Someone with leadership experience and enthusiasm for safety who clearly communicates and reinforces their organization's safety practices can make for an effective safety leader.
